Understanding Eco-Friendly Tourism
At its heart, eco-conscious tourism refers to practices that minimize negative impact on the environment, traditions, and economies of regions visited. The goal is to protect native heritage and benefit the well-being of the local inhabitants.
Benefits of Sustainable Travel
Nature Conservation: By choosing sustainable travel options, we contribute to in saving biodiversity and lowering pollution levels.
Heritage Respect: Participating in local communities allows a greater comprehension of traditions, ensuring these cultures are maintained and honored.
Supporting Local Economies: By lodging in local hotels and partaking in homegrown businesses, travelers enhance the economic development of the region.
How to Adopt Eco-Friendly Tourism**
- Travel Light: Consider only essentials to lessen carbon emissions.
- Choose Eco-Friendly Stays: Choose hotels that follow sustainable policies.
- Support Community-Based Services: Prioritize local restaurants and markets to ensure positive impact.
